One Griffith man is waiting for the chance to travel after scooping a $61,000 Keno prize. The retiree's eight numbers lined up during Keno game 170 on Wednesday.

"I always play eight numbers and I never watch the draw, so I spent a little bit of time not knowing I'd won," he said.
"Last night a mate called me up to tell me that someone down at the club had won the Eight Spot, so I thought I'd better go check my ticket!
"When I checked my ticket, I got such a surprise."
The $61,965.90 prize will be deposited at the bank while pandemic travel restrictions are still in place.
"That will give me time to make a little bit of a plan, but I am retired so I have no doubt I will find plenty of ways to enjoy it," the man said.
"When restrictions are lifted and we can travel further afield, I will take a holiday."
The winning ticket was played at the Coro Club.
"We couldn't believe it when we realised someone in our venue had won more than $60,000," club staff member Bianca Sutton said.
"Everyone was so excited for the winner."
